The Utah Utes will have revenge on their minds when the Beavers from Oregon State come to Ogden for this Thursday Night showdown on ESPN. In last year’s game, The Beavers easily took care of the Utes 24-7 on opening day. The Oregon State Beavers are coming off a huge 27-21 win over then top ranked Southern Cal. Fifteenth ranked Utah is coming off an easy 37-21 victory over FCS opponent Weber State. Utah rested all of their starters after three quarters of play. The Utes are off to their best start star since going 12-0 in 2004. The Utes started the season off by going into Ann Arbor and upsetting the Michigan Wolverines. This game is big for quarterback Brian Johnson. Johnson was injured and lost for the season in last year’s game against the Beavers. Johnson has been very impressive this season completing 69% of his passes for 1129 yards and 8 touchdowns. The Utes are also sporting one of the toughest defenses in the country. The Utes have the best defense in the Mountain West allowing just 231.4 yards per game. The Utes are especially stingy on the ground allowing a miniscule 60.2 yards per game. The Beavers have a short week and have to deal with distractions on and off the filed that come with pulling the biggest upset of the season.
